This is the page of my 'home' club, Texas Swing. Texas Swing members dance A2 most Fridays at the Dibden Purlieu W.I. hall and enjoy the good fortune of dancing to three callers: Keith Lovegrove, Rob Branson and Rob James. Latest Friday Founded by Texans Al (who was temporarily transferred to Exxon's Fawley site) and Linda Singleton in 1990, the club developed to be the strongest square dance club in the south of England during the early and middle part of the decade. When Al and Linda were 'moved on' by Exxon, the club continued to be run, firstly by a co-ordinator (Norman Foster), and then by a committee. In 2004, personality and policy differences resulted in a formal division after a vote by all the club members. Plus and Mainstream dancers formed a new club (Waterside Squares) whilst Advanced dancers continued to organise and promote Texas Swing. The club is still a 'member run' club although the current organisation is much less formal than in previous years.
